A T-bone steak provides 6.90 x 102 food Calories (Cal) . A food Calorie is equivalent to 4180 J of heat energy. The heat energy provided by the steak would be sufficient to heat 59.1 kg of water how many Celsius degrees. The specific heat of water is 4.18 J/g °C.
A) 6.58 °C
B) 11.7 °C
C) 9.20 °C
D) 23.6 C
